Memoirs of the Life, Religious Experience, Ministerial Travels, and Labours of Mrs. Elaw /
"The memoirs of Zilpha Elaw, an antebellum Black woman, document the first twenty years of her forty-year itinerant ministry as a Methodist preacher in the United States and England in the 1800s. With an introduction, annotations, and timeline by Kimberly D. Blockett"--
